Scott Davidson
3 月之前
No account linked to committer's email address
|
|
|
@@ -64,6 +64,15 @@ spec: |
|
|
|
{{- . | toYaml | nindent 12 }} |
|
|
|
{{- end }} |
|
|
|
{{- if .Values.redis.persistence.enabled }} |
|
|
|
{{- with .Values.redis.persistence.retentionPolicy }} |
|
|
|
persistentVolumeClaimRetentionPolicy: |
|
|
|
{{- with .whenDeleted }} |
|
|
|
whenDeleted: {{ . }} |
|
|
|
{{- end }} |
|
|
|
{{- with .whenScaled }} |
|
|
|
whenScaled: {{ . }} |
|
|
|
{{- end }} |
|
|
|
{{- end }} |
|
|
|
volumeClaimTemplates: |
|
|
|
- metadata: |
|
|
|
name: redis-data |
|
|
|
@@ -187,6 +187,11 @@ redis: |
|
|
|
capacity: 5Gi |
|
|
|
persistence: |
|
|
|
enabled: true |
|
|
|
# Set's the retention policy for the persistent storage (only available in k8s 1.32 or later) |
|
|
|
# https://kubernetes.io/docs/concepts/workloads/controllers/statefulset/#persistentvolumeclaim-retention |
|
|
|
# retentionPolicy: |
|
|
|
# whenDeleted: Delete |
|
|
|
# whenScaled: Delete |
|
|
|
deployment: |
|
|
|
strategy: |
|
|
|
resources: |